Serving 128 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Sherwood Global Studies Academy 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 6-9%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 15-19%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 12: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 87%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Michigan state average of 36% (majority Black and Hispanic).

Sherwood Global Studies Academy's student population of 128 students has declined by 55% over five school years.
The teacher population of 11 teachers has declined by 38% over five school years.
